OX26 4HR is a safe, established residential area on Magdalen Close, 0.5km from Woodfield in Bicester. Administratively it sits within Bicester East ward and the Banbury constituency.
For families considering a move, OX26 4HR represents a culturally diverse area with a strong community identity. An average age of 45 puts this squarely in mixed-family territory — professional couples, school-age children households, and established residents all sharing the streets. 79% of properties are owner-occupied — a strong indicator of neighbourhood stability and long-term community investment.
Safety: Crime rates are low here at 25 incidents per 1,000 residents — well below average and reassuring for families. Property: Average house prices are around £295k.
Census 2021 statistics for OX26 4HR are sourced from Output Area E00145008 (shared with 15 postcodes in this micro-neighbourhood). Property prices come from HM Land Registry.

gavel Crime Overview 12 Months (up to 2026-02)
OX26 4HR has low crime rates — 25 incidents per 1,000 residents. The most reported categories are violence and sexual offences and anti-social behaviour. Commercial streets and transport hubs naturally generate more incidents than quiet residential roads.
